About Arvinderpal S. Wander

Arvinderpal S. Wander is a scholar working on Hardware and Architecture, Information Systems and Computer Networks and Communications, having authored 4 papers that have together received 596 indexed citations. Recurring topics across this work include Cryptography and Data Security (2 papers), Cryptography and Residue Arithmetic (2 papers) and Software-Defined Networks and 5G (1 paper). The work is most often cited by research in Computer Networks and Communications (483 citations), Artificial Intelligence (206 citations) and Information Systems (103 citations). Arvinderpal S. Wander has collaborated with scholars based in United States, United Kingdom and Germany. Frequent co-authors include Nils Gura, Hans Eberle, Vipul Gupta, Sheueling Chang Shantz, Christof Paar, Arun Singh Patel and André Weimerskirch.
